Join a Legacy of Hope and Empowerment at Covenant House New York!

For over 50 years Covenant House New York (CHNY) has been at the forefront of transforming lives by providing comprehensive shelter housing and wraparound support services for vulnerable homeless runaway and exploited youth. As the largest provider of these essential services in New York City CHNY impacts the lives of over 1500 young people aged 1624 every year.

At CHNY our doors are open to all young people in need regardless of race religion sexual orientation gender identity and expression. Our dedicated team offers various services including shelter housing education employment health mental health support youth development and antihuman trafficking initiatives. We operate with harm reduction and traumainformed principles to ensure the best care for our youth.

Job Summary

The Older Female Program is seeking an Evening Resident Advisor (RA) provides supportive services to 20 single young women identified as ages 2124 at a shelter site in the Bronx funded by the Department of Youth and Community Development. Reporting to the shelter sites program coordinator the RA is an energetic creative and diligent team member including case managers and specialty support staff. RAs will be expected to participate in training and implementation activities for evidencebased and other proven models that will be utilized.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

(Responsibilities to include but not limited to the following)

Youth Engagement and Program Support

  • Directly engages supervises and supports youth residing at the Older Females shelter site providing support motivation and encouragement when needed.
  • Ensures that the site including youths rooms is clean and kept in a good and safe condition.
  • Assists youth in achieving their shelter goals: assesses and addresses any immediate trauma experienced by the young female seeking shelter and assists clients in obtaining their goals.
  • Welcomes the young femaleidentified to the site and orients them to site expectations CHNYs mission and principles and child protection policies and protocols.
  • Assists young females identified with preparation for the day. Ensures the young femaleidentified are awake out of bed fed and promptly on their way to work school or other activities.
  • Provides support to Case Managers as needed including distributing appointment slips appointment followup paperwork collection and filing file maintenance and file compliance.
  • Maintains records in the Efforts to Outcomes (ETO) computer system and enters all required documentation timely.
  • Escorts young femaleidentified to other agencies and services when necessary (e.g. hospitals school visits) when feasible.
  • Maintains healthy supportive relationships with the young femaleidentified mindful of boundaries and mutual respect.
  • Leads and/or participates in recreational and holiday activities at the site and offsite trips.
  • Complete incident reports by the end of the shift and submit them to appropriate parties.
  • Deescalates crises; attends to emergencies following agency protocol.
  • Ensures safety by utilizing security training throughout their shifts including searching belongings and rooms.
  • Works as a collaborative team member ensuring that all young men have access to highquality services and are living in a safe and compassionate community.
  • Participates in regular case conferences. Ensures team members are fully apprised of important information.
  • Actively participates in staff team meetings individual supervision meetings and meetings with the young men.
  • Assists with audit preparation and dry and live audits of the program.
